What Is Health Care?
Health care, often referred to as healthcare, is a broad term encompassing a range of services and practices designed to promote, maintain, and restore health. It includes preventive measures, medical treatments, and interventions aimed at improving the quality of life for individuals and communities.
The Pillars of Health Care
- Preventive Care: Proactive steps taken to prevent illnesses and promote wellness, such as vaccinations and regular check-ups.
- Primary Care: The initial point of contact for individuals seeking healthcare services, usually provided by general practitioners or family doctors.
- Specialty Care: Specialized medical care is provided by healthcare professionals with expertise in specific fields, such as cardiology, dermatology, or orthopedics.
- Emergency Care: Immediate medical attention for life-threatening situations, often provided in hospital emergency rooms.
- Mental Health Care: Support and treatment for mental health disorders, emphasizing emotional and psychological well-being.
- Long-Term Care: Ongoing assistance for individuals with chronic illnesses or disabilities, often in nursing homes or through home healthcare services.

Health Insurance
Health insurance is a financial safeguard that helps cover medical expenses. Types of health insurance include:
- Private Health Insurance
- Medicare (for seniors)
- Medicaid (for low-income individuals)
- Employer-Sponsored Insurance
Government Regulations
Government agencies, such as the FDA (Food and Drug Administration) and CDC (Centers for Disease Control and Prevention), play a vital role in ensuring the safety and effectiveness of medical treatments and public health.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: What is the role of health insurance in healthcare?
Health insurance helps individuals cover medical expenses, making healthcare more affordable. It provides financial protection in case of unexpected illnesses or injuries.
Q: How can I choose the right healthcare provider?
To find the right healthcare provider, consider factors like their specialization, location, and patient reviews. Consult your primary care physician for recommendations.
Q: What are the benefits of preventive care?
Preventive care helps detect health issues early, reducing the severity and cost of treatment. It also promotes overall wellness and longevity.
Q: Can I switch health insurance plans?
Yes, you can switch health insurance plans during open enrollment periods or after major life events like marriage or the birth of a child. Consult your insurance provider for details.
Q: How can I access mental health care services?
To access mental health care services, you can start by talking to your primary care physician, who can provide referrals to mental health specialists or counselors.
Q: Are there any government programs for low-income individuals without health insurance?
Yes, Medicaid is a government program that provides healthcare coverage to eligible low-income individuals and families.
